Titration period

Titration is a procedure doctors use to determine the optimal dosage of medication. It could take a few weeks before you get the proper dosage. There are many factors that affect the amount of titrate. These include the patient's weight and height, as well as the severity of symptoms, and other medical conditions.

Adults suffering from ADHD typically have a titration duration of between two and six weeks. This is because the drug requires time to begin working. However, it's important to keep in touch with your doctor, especially in the event that your child isn't receiving benefits after the titration period is complete.

Titration is a complicated procedure and it's essential to be aware of it. Patients should monitor their symptoms and document any adverse reactions. If they experience problems or have a problem, it could be a sign that the medication isn't working or that the dosage is not the best for them.

In titration, a physician will increase the dosage until it is safe and efficient. Sometimes, the titration time for adults with ADHD can take a lengthy duration.
